State Police arrested 31 year old Kerri Bunnelle of Little Falls for Vehicular Manslaughter, Aggravated Unlicensed Operation of a motor vehicle and Aggravated DWI, following the investigation into an August 4 accident last year old State Route 8 in New Berlin, that killed 43 year old Matthew Fredericks of Herkimer. Police stated that Bunnelle was the driver of a GMC Envoy that crossed over into a Ford Focus head-on driven by Fredericks, who did not survive the crash. Bunnelle’s blood alcohol content was .23% & she also did not possess a valid drivers license. Bunnelle was virtually arraigned in the town of Norwich court and released on her own recognizance. She will appear in the Chenango County Court at a later date.
Sidney Police Department responded Thursday to a disturbance at a business in the Village. 34 year old Michael Ide of Otego was wanted on active arrest warrant from the City of Oneonta, he allegedly had a small quantity of crack cocaine and methamphetamines, he was charged with 2 counts of Criminal possession of a controlled substance & Aggravated unlicensed operation of a motor vehicle, he was released on appearance tickets and turned over to the City of Oneonta Police Department. That arrest led Sidney Police to request a State Police K9 unit to search a vehicle, where narcotics, drug paraphernalia, packaging material, a rifle and ammunition were discovered, 34 year old Brandon MacLaury of Guilford was charged with Criminal possession of a controlled substance with intent to sell, and Criminal possession of a weapon, he was virtually arraigned & was released & will appear in court at a later date.

Chenango County Sheriff’s Deputies arrested Matthew Maclaury of Oxford for aggravated driving while intoxicated and DWI after a report of a 2-car accident on County Road 32 in the Town of Norwich it was found that Maclaury went off the roadway and struck a parked vehicle & that Maclaury was driving with a blood alcohol content of .18 or higher. Maclaury will appear in the Town of Norwich Court at a later date.
